Job description

Sodexo is seeking a Patient Dining Services Manager to lead patient dining operations at MedStar Washington Hospital Center, a 900-bed facility in Washington, DC. This role focuses on exceptional service, quality, safety, and patient satisfaction.

Join a team where patients are at the heart of everything we do. The Patient Dining Services Manager will lead and inspire staff while ensuring every meal experience reflects MedStar’s commitment to compassionate care, clinical excellence, and outstanding

About The Job

Join a role that blends operational leadership with service excellence in a healthcare setting. You’ll oversee mailroom services alongside patient dining operations, ensuring efficient workflows, regulatory compliance, and a consistently positive experience for patients, staff, and visitors.

What You’ll Bring
  • Experience guiding frontline teams within service-driven operations such as mailroom, dining, or healthcare support services.
  • Knowledge of patient dining workflows, food safety, sanitation, and clinical nutrition standards.
  • Background in staff scheduling, onboarding, and day-to-day operational coordination.
  • Commitment to service excellence through patient engagement, rounding, and quality monitoring.
  • Organizational skills that support workflow management, performance standards, and continuous improvement.
